Niosomes are nanosized vesicles composed of nonionic surfactants and cholesterol that type when these compounds are dispersed in an aqueous medium. These lipid-based constructions are just like liposomes but vary in their composition, as niosomes use nonionic surfactants in place of phospholipids. The exclusive attribute of niosomes lies of their capability to encapsulate both hydrophilic and hydrophobic drugs in their bilayer membrane.

Dosing Frequency: Due to the longer release time, ER prescription drugs typically require much less doses—at times just at the time per day—when SR medications could need to be taken two or more instances per day.
Coating enhances balance, bioavailability, and aesthetic attraction even though catering to distinct formulation demands like flavor masking and delayed release.
SR provides a slower release after some time but may possibly involve many doses throughout the day. ER gives an extended release, usually as much as 24 hrs, enabling for once-every day dosing.

Colon drug delivery and ways can target drugs precisely to your colon by means of a variety of pH sensitive, time controlled, or microbially activated mechanisms. Drugs appropriate for colon targeting consist of These for inflammatory bowel illness, colon cancer, protein/peptide delivery, and infectious conditions.
